Wreckfest - Tournament Update August 2021 - Salutes Carmageddon

Carmageddon has come to Wreckfest! Celebrate the start of a new Tournament season and relive the legendary Carmageddon series.

The story is too old to be commented.
crazyCoconuts85d ago

Man this takes me back. I wonder if they licenced Iron Maiden music for the full effect